GUI.RepeatButton

public static bool RepeatButton(Rect position, string text);
public static bool RepeatButton(Rect position, Texture image);
public static bool RepeatButton(Rect position, GUIContent content);
public static bool RepeatButton(Rect position, string text, GUIStyle style);
public static bool RepeatButton(Rect position, Texture image, GUIStyle style);
public static bool RepeatButton(Rect position, GUIContent content, GUIStyle style);

Parameters

positionRectangle on the screen to use for the button.
textText to display on the button.
image Texture to display on the button.
contentText, image and tooltip for this button.
styleThe style to use. If left out, the button style from the current GUISkin is used.

Returns

bool True when the users clicks the button.

Description

Make a button that is active as long as the user holds it down.

// Draws 2 buttons, one with an image, and other with a text
// Prints a message when they get clicked.

// Prints a message when they get clicked.

using UnityEngine; using System.Collections;

public class Example : MonoBehaviour { public Texture btnTexture;

void OnGUI() { if (!btnTexture) { Debug.LogError("Please assign a texture on the inspector"); return; }

if (GUI.RepeatButton(new Rect(10, 10, 50, 50), btnTexture)) Debug.Log("Clicked the button with an image");

if (GUI.RepeatButton(new Rect(10, 70, 50, 30), "Click")) Debug.Log("Clicked the button with text"); } }
